What are the three requirements for geothermal energy?
Accessible heat source, heat transfer medium, and a steam/electric generator
It is impractical to try to tap magma directly, so the geothermal energy must be accessible in a controlled manner. Typically, the heat transfer occurs via ground water that is flashed into steam by the hot rock and is extractable through built piping or natural vents.
If one wants to produce electrical power, the steam must be used to drive a turbine that powers a generator; if not, thermal energy can be produced with a straightforward, locally focused steam distribution system.
In order to minimize water losses over time, the steam condensate is typically recycled back into the rock formation.
